Kong Jianping, Chairman of Zhejiang Haowei Technology, clarified: Hangzhou has not taken special action against blockchain practitioners.
According to Gate News bot, Wu Shuo reported that Kong Jianping, chairman of Zhejiang Haowei Technology Co., Ltd. and director of Hong Kong Cyberport Management Company, responded to recent public opinion hotspots. After meeting with several key leaders in Hangzhou, Kong Jianping stated that Zhejiang and Hangzhou have not taken special actions against personnel in the blockchain industry.
According to the information that Kong Jianping learned from the public security department, there are currently no relevant law enforcement actions targeting this industry, and some individual cases are only related to anti-fraud work. He added that in his communication with the leaders in Hangzhou, he found that the other party did not show excessive sensitivity to the fields related to Blockchain and cryptocurrency.
